New Year. New fitness routine. It is a familiar thought. You want to try out a new class because your routine is getting a little old. Most gyms offer some sort of kickboxing class for all levels, but be warned, this will not be easy. This is not for the casual exerciser or the dangerously uncoordinated. Blaring pop music, multiple phases of equipment and your own lack of rhythm will all work against you. If you commit and do a little preparation, you will be glad you fought the overwhelming urge to walk out after the first 15 minutes.

Before your first class, consider a little preparation.

Check out some basic kickboxing moves. Your teacher will have some choreography she or he has put together, but it never hurts to be vaguely familiar with the moves that will inevitably be recycled.

Bring your own weights and jump rope in case the equipment at your gym is not your size. It is frustrating to work with a bad jump rope or weights that are too heavy, especially if the moves are not complicated.

Definitely pack some water because you will need it. If you are a walker or a jogger, you will experience a different level of dehydration during this hour.

In the end, don’t worry and have fun! It is just a class and learning something new is always a positive, even if you don’t unlock a secret athletic talent.

Interior Upgrades Begin Rolling Out Across United Fleet

United Airlines is in the midst of a major initiative to modernize its fleet over the next several years. After first announcing the plan in 2021, planes fitted with United’s signature interior are finally beginning to appear across the airline’s narrowbody fleet of Boeing and Airbus planes. United flyers are sure to notice these enhancements from the moment they step on board: Each new or updated plane sports remodeled seats, seatback entertainment screens for everyone, Bluetooth connectivity and more, all adding up to a better experience on every journey.

Fairfield by Marriott Brand Debuts in Copenhagen

Fairfield by Marriott Copenhagen Nordhavn recently debuted in Denmark. The opening marks the European debut of Marriott’s Fairfield by Marriott brand. The design prototype from OCCA Design Studio will be used as the blueprint for future Fairfield by Marriott properties throughout Europe.

You Can Now Pool Your Points with United Airlines

Earlier this month, United Airlines announced MileagePlus members can pool points. Up to five friends and family members can now combine frequent-flyer miles to redeem for travel.

The Argosaronic Islands Are Calling

The Saronic or Argo Saronic Islands of Greece call travelers to explore its seven small islands and islets brimming with history, natural sites and more. With most easily accessible by boat, the islands’ proximity to ports of Athens make the Saronic Islands an ideal destination for those preferring shorter boat rides. In fact, trips from Athens ports to the islands take only between 10 minutes and two hours, depending on the island you choose, making them perfect for day or weekend trips.

Regent Santa Monica Beach to Debut This Summer

Located steps away from the iconic Santa Monica Pier, Regent Santa Monica Beach is set to welcome travelers this summer. The highly anticipated opening represents the first destination in America for the reimagined Regent Hotel & Resorts brand, part of IHG Hotels & Resorts’ luxury and lifestyle portfolio.
